Diablo 4 Season 9 has just begun, and it's a great time to dive into Blizzard's gargantuan ARPG. After some ups and downs, the Warcraft and Starcraft developer's latest update has the game in a good place, and you can currently grab both the base game and its expansion, Vessel of Hatred, at a lower price than they've ever been before on Steam. You'll need to move fast, however, as there's just over one day to snag this saving.

The new Diablo 4 season delves back into the Horadrim, one of the main factions in its story. Long-time players might find it a little by-the-books mechanically, but that's because Blizzard has found a formula that works, and as a new player you'll be in a perfect position to take advantage of all the tuning and updates we've had since launch. Its campaign remains a highlight, with Lauren scoring it the elusive 10/10 and then following that up with a similarly effusive Diablo 4 Vessel of Hatred review.

Even among competition from heavy hitters such as Path of Exile 2, Diablo 4 holds a very worthy spot among our best RPGs, and it's certainly the most immediately approachable of its ilk. Start now, and you'll have an even better time working through the story than you would have back at launch, and if you make it to the endgame you'll be able to take advantage of the newly introduced Horadric Spells system, which lets you craft your own custom abilities to complement our best Diablo 4 builds.

Blizzard has also rolled out its latest loot overhaul with Season 9; with gear in a pretty good place these days, its most recent change is an increase to the quality of drops you'll find as you crank up the difficulty levels. That means you're encouraged to see how much challenge you can handle, and will be rewarded for your success by finding upgrades more frequently. If you've been on the fence, the current Steam sale is a good time to take the plunge.

Diablo 4 and Vessel of Hatred are 50% off on Steam until Thursday July 10 at 10am PT / 1pm ET / 6pm BST / 7pm CEST. You'll pay $24.99 / £20.99 for the base game and $19.99 / £17.49 for the expansion, or can get the pair in a bundle for $41.99 / £35.99 to save a little more.
